Pistol Qualification

by Derek—2005.11.22 @ 1943

I had an opportunity to go down to Fort A.P. Hill in Virginia to take some photographs during a 9mm pistol qualification event. The mood was a bit dreary: overcast, cold, and wet. Dressed in body armor and and kevlar, I took position on the line with those qualifying and took pictures in the drizzly rain.

The rain and cold was not enough to dampen the spirits of those involved, except for a few cold, wet hands. After most of the soldiers had qualified, they had some extra ammunition that needed to be used so they asked if anyone wanted to shoot again. I volunteered. The pistol action was a little stiff in the rain and my hands were also numb from the cold, but the qualification wasn’t difficult at all. I scored 270/300 and received the “Expert Marksman” badge. I missed three targets (each worth 10 points each) by just being lazy.
